Umblubblub · 27/10/2016 20:01

Find out where his office will be;
Work out which of the major stations he could use to get into London;
Check out all the train lines going into those stations where the journey time is what he'd be prepared to do, and the trains are frequent enough for his needs;
Research the areas around the stations on those lines until you find something you like the look of.

We did a similar thing when we moved from Central London out to the suburbs, good luck!
